What You'll Do
You'll help us bring big wins to our customers by tackling some of their most complex technical issues across the Cisco Security portfolio. The Advanced Threat Escalations team seeks a motivated, experienced Escalations Engineer to join our fantastic team in Prague.

You'll be responsible for resolving complex technical issues (escalated by Cisco CX), filing new product defects, creating training and documentation, and partnering with our Engineering and Product Management teams on new product releases.

AMP for Endpoints and Threat Grid are two of the fastest growing products in Cisco's security portfolio, and you will have a fantastic opportunity to use your skills to provide creative solutions for our growing customer base.

Who You Are
You're an experienced support engineer who has experience not just in IT Security, but also stays current with troubleshooting methodology on various operating systems. Cisco related certifications (e.g. CCNA or CCNP) will give you an edge, but we are looking for someone who has experience in multiple areas, to confidently troubleshoot multi-product and integration relates issues.

You have knowledge of networking, but also need experience in application support, and advanced level troubleshooting in at least two out of three major client OS (Windows, macOS, Linux). Any experience with Apple iOS would be a major plus.

Strong collaboration and communication (particularly presentation and written) skills are essential to succeed in this role. Experience with both SQL and NoSQL databases would be advantageous, as would any scripting experience.

Requirements for this role:
• At least 5 years of IT Support experience, focused in IT Security
• Experience supporting Windows and macOS or Linux OS, both client and server
• At least two years experience deploying and supporting anti-malware solutions (Cisco, McAfee, Symantec, Microsoft)
• Knowledge of security products (Firewalls, IDS/IPS, Proxies)
• Previous experience collaborating with multiple teams to resolve technical issues
• Fluent (verbal and written) in English
